Just what is a Robotic Vacuum Cleaner?
At its core, a robotic vacuum cleaner is an autonomous device created to tidy floors without direct human control. These clever devices are geared up with a mix of sensors, motors, and cleaning components that operate in consistency to browse your home and get rid of dust, dirt, and particles. Generally circular or D-shaped, they are created to manoeuvre under furniture, around obstacles, and along edges, ensuring an extensive clean across various floor types.
Robotic vacuums run on rechargeable batteries and are configured to clean autonomously. They use a range of navigation methods, from basic bump-and-go systems to sophisticated mapping innovations, to cover your floors. Once cleaning is total or their battery is low, many models will automatically go back to their charging dock, ready for their next cleaning cycle.

Navigating the Features: Key Considerations When Choosing Your Robotic Vacuum Cleaner in the UK
The UK market uses a diverse range of robotic vacuum cleaners, each boasting different features and capabilities. To make a notified choice, consider these crucial elements:
1. Navigation and Mapping: This is a crucial element identifying how effectively your robot cleans and covers your home. There are several navigation technologies:
Random Bounce (Basic): These entry-level designs move in random instructions, bouncing off challenges till they have covered the location. While budget friendly, they are less efficient and may miss out on spots or repeatedly clean the very same locations.Organized Navigation (Patterned Cleaning): These robots tidy in a more structured pattern, such as rows or zig-zags, resulting in more effective protection. They typically use sensors to prevent challenges but might not create detailed maps.Smart Mapping (LiDAR, Camera-Based): Advanced models utilise L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) or camera-based systems to develop comprehensive maps of your home. This enables for:Efficient Path Planning: The robot can prepare ideal cleaning routes, guaranteeing extensive protection.Selective Room Cleaning: You can define which rooms to tidy through an app.Virtual Boundaries: Set up virtual walls or no-go zones to avoid the robot from entering particular locations.Real-time Obstacle Avoidance: More sophisticated things recognition helps them avoid smaller challenges like shoes or pet toys.
2. Suction Power: Measured in Pascals (Pa), suction power identifies how efficiently the robot can get dirt and particles. Greater suction power is usually better for carpets and homes with family pets. Consider your floor types:
Hard Floors: Lower suction power might be sufficient for tough floors like wood, tile, or laminate.Carpets and Rugs: Higher suction power is needed to successfully lift dirt and particles from carpet fibers. Search for designs with functions like carpet boost, which instantly increase suction when carpet is detected.
3. Battery Life and Coverage: Battery life dictates for how long the robot can clean on a single charge, directly affecting the area it can cover.
Home Size: Consider the size of your home. Bigger homes will need robots with longer battery life.Charging Time: Check the charging time. Faster charging is convenient, specifically for larger homes requiring numerous cleaning cycles.Auto-Dock and Recharge: Most robotic vacuums will instantly go back to their charging dock when the battery is low and resume cleaning later on if required.

Keeping Your Robotic Vacuum for Longevity
To guarantee your robotic vacuum runs effectively and has a long lifespan, regular upkeep is vital. Here are some essential upkeep tasks:
Empty the Dustbin Regularly: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ning cycle or as required. A complete dustbin decreases suction power.Clean Brushes and Rollers: Regularly get rid of and clean the primary brush roll and side brushes. Hair and particles can tangle around them, impeding efficiency.Clean Filters: Clean or replace filters according to the maker's instructions. Tidy filters maintain suction power and air quality.Wipe Sensors: Gently wipe sensing units with a soft, dry fabric to get rid of dust and ensure accurate navigation.Check and Clean Wheels: Remove any twisted hair or debris from the robot's wheels for smooth movement.Software Updates (if applicable): If your robot has app connection, guarantee you keep the software updated for optimal performance and access to brand-new functions.

How much do robotic vacuum expense in the UK?Rates range substantially from around ₤ 150 for basic designs to over ₤ 1000 for premium designs with sophisticated functions like self-emptying and advanced navigation.
For how long do robotic vacuum last?With correct upkeep, a great quality robotic vacuum can last for a number of years, typically 3-5 years or even longer. Battery life-span is an essential factor and might need replacing after a couple of years depending upon usage.
Are robotic vacuum appropriate for all floor types?A lot of robotic vacuum cleaners are developed to deal with various floor types, including hard floors, carpets, and rugs. However, consider suction power and brush roll design based upon your predominant floor types. Some models are much better matched for carpets, while others excel on difficult floors.
Are robotic vacuum cleaners loud?Robotic vacuums are usually quieter than traditional vacuums, however they are not silent. Noise levels differ between designs, generally varying from around 55 to 70 decibels.
Can robotic vacuum deal with stairs?No, standard robotic vacuum cleaners can not climb up stairs. They are created for cleaning single-level floors. For multi-level homes, you would need to manually move the robot in between floorings or consider having numerous robotics.
